两个服务之间调用,你会用服务级令牌还是用户级令牌?分别适用于什么场景?For service-to-service calls, would you use a service token or a user token? When does each apply?
国内高频海外高频进阶#auth#security#api-design分析过程 · 先想清楚再作答
- 题眼在「分别」。答「用户级更安全」就把一道设计题做成了口号题——面试官想看你能不能说出两者各自成立的条件,以及选错的具体代价。
- 先给判断依据,一句话就能拆开:这次调用**有没有一个具体的用户在背后**。有,就必须是用户级;没有(拉配置、上报指标、跑对账批处理),服务级才是对的,硬塞一个用户 id 进去反而是伪造审计记录。
- 然后把用户级的三条理由说成代价而不是优点:服务级令牌泄露一次等于全量用户数据泄露,用户级泄露一张只丢一个用户且十五分钟自动作废;服务级在审计日志里只能查到「某服务调了一次」,查不到替谁操作;下游做用户级权限判断时,服务级令牌逼着它去信请求体里的 userId,而那是调用方可以随便写的。
- 补一句生产视角:两者不是二选一,真实系统里常常是「服务级令牌用来换用户级令牌」——调用方先用自己的服务凭证证明自己是谁,再申请一张代表某个用户的短期令牌。这样服务凭证只出现在铸造这一步,不出现在每一次业务调用里。
- 可以预期的追问一:令牌泄露了怎么办?答案要分两层——短有效期(本课 15 分钟)是止损的主力,撤销列表按 jti 拉黑是补充;不要上来就说「用黑名单」,那等于给每次验签加一次数据库查询,把无状态验签的好处全赔进去了。
- 可以预期的追问二:那 scope 该切多细?给一条可操作的判据——按「读写不对称的风险」切,读错了泄露信息、写错了污染数据且会持续影响后续每一轮对话,所以 read 和 write 必须分开;再细就要看有没有真实的调用方只需要其中一半。
How to reason about it · think before answering
- The hinge is each. Answering user tokens are safer turns a design question into a slogan — the interviewer wants the conditions under which each one is correct, and the concrete cost of choosing wrong.
- Give the deciding question first: is there a specific user behind this call? If yes, it must be a user token. If not — fetching config, reporting metrics, running a reconciliation batch — a service token is the right answer, and stuffing in a user id would fabricate audit history.
- Then state the three reasons as costs, not virtues. A leaked service token means every user's data at once; a leaked user token means one user, and it expires in fifteen minutes. Audit logs with a service token only show that some service called, never on whose behalf. And a downstream service doing per-user authorization is forced to trust a userId in the request body, which the caller writes freely.
- Add the production view: it is rarely either-or. Real systems use the service credential to obtain user tokens — the caller proves who it is once, then mints a short-lived token representing one user. The service credential then appears only at the minting step, never on every business call.
- Expect: what if a token leaks? Answer in two layers — a short lifetime (fifteen minutes here) does most of the containment, and a jti denylist is the supplement. Do not lead with a denylist: it puts a database lookup in front of every verification and gives away the whole point of stateless verification.
- Expect: how fine-grained should scopes be? Offer a usable rule — split along asymmetric risk. A bad read leaks information; a bad write poisons data that keeps influencing every later turn. So read and write always split; finer than that only if a real caller genuinely needs just one half.
答题要点
- 判断依据是「这次调用背后有没有一个具体用户」:有就用用户级,没有(配置、指标、对账批处理)才用服务级
- 服务级令牌泄露的爆炸半径是全量用户,用户级只影响一个用户且短期自动失效
- 审计要能落到人:只有 sub 字段能回答「当时是替谁操作的」
- 下游要做用户级权限判断时,服务级令牌逼着它去信请求体里的 userId,而那是调用方可以伪造的
- 生产里常见组合:服务凭证只用来换取代表某个用户的短期令牌,不出现在每次业务调用里
- 泄露后的止损顺序是短有效期优先、jti 撤销列表补充,别一上来就上黑名单换掉无状态验签
Key points
- The deciding question is whether a specific user stands behind the call: yes means user token, no (config, metrics, reconciliation) means service token
- A leaked service token exposes every user; a leaked user token exposes one and expires on its own
- Auditing has to reach a person — only the sub claim answers who the call was made on behalf of
- With a service token the downstream must trust a userId in the request body, which the caller can forge
- Common production shape: the service credential only buys short-lived per-user tokens and never appears on business calls
- After a leak, short lifetimes do the containment and a jti denylist supplements it — do not trade away stateless verification by default
JWKS 验签是怎么工作的?为什么跨服务场景下它比共享密钥更合适?How does JWKS-based verification work, and why does it fit cross-service scenarios better than a shared secret?
国内高频海外高频基础#auth#jwt#security分析过程 · 先想清楚再作答
- 这是本章的送分题,但送分题也有区分度:能不能把「密钥轮换」这件事讲成一个具体的运维动作,而不是一句「更方便管理」。
- 先讲机制,三句话:签发方持私钥签名,公钥集合挂在一个固定地址上(本课用 /.well-known/jwks.json);令牌头部带一个 kid,验签方按 kid 从集合里挑对应的公钥;验签只用公钥,所以这个地址是公开的,谁都能拉。
- 再讲为什么比共享密钥好,三条都要落到运维动作上:轮换不用两边同时发版(新旧两把公钥并存一段时间,等老令牌自然过期再摘旧的);验签方拿到的只是验签能力而不是签名能力,被入侵也伪造不出令牌;多一个调用方不用多散一份密钥出去。
- 然后主动补上最容易被忽略的一段:验签不等于验完。签名合法只说明「这确实是那个签发方签的」,还必须校验 iss、aud、exp——**漏掉 aud 是跨服务集成里最常见的事故**,因为签发方给别的下游服务签的令牌,签名一样合法,不校验受众就等于替别人的接口开门。
- 工程细节可以再加两条:公钥集合要缓存,但遇到没见过的 kid 要能主动重拉,否则轮换那一刻会集体失败;以及时钟偏移,exp 校验要留一点容忍度,但容忍度不能大到把短有效期的意义抵消掉。
- 可以预期的追问:那 HS256 是不是就不能用了?答「同一个服务自己签自己验时它没问题,而且更快」——判据是签名方和验签方是不是同一个信任域,跨了域就必须非对称。这么答显得你在做权衡而不是背结论。
How to reason about it · think before answering
- This is the giveaway question of the chapter, but it still separates people: can you turn key rotation into a concrete operational sequence rather than saying it is easier to manage?
- Describe the mechanism in three sentences. The issuer holds the private key and signs; the public key set is published at a fixed address (/.well-known/jwks.json here); the token header carries a kid, and the verifier picks the matching public key from the set. Verification needs only public material, so the endpoint is public by design.
- Then give three reasons, each as an operational action: rotation needs no synchronized deploy on both sides (publish the new public key, let both coexist, drop the old one after old tokens expire); the verifier holds verification power, not signing power, so compromising it does not let anyone forge tokens; and adding a caller does not scatter another copy of a secret.
- Volunteer the part people forget: verifying the signature is not the whole check. A valid signature only proves the issuer signed it. You still validate iss, aud and exp — and missing aud is the most common cross-service incident, because a token the issuer signed for a different downstream is equally well signed, so skipping audience means holding the door open for someone else's API.
- Two engineering details worth adding: cache the key set but refetch on an unknown kid, or rotation day becomes a mass failure; and allow a small clock skew on exp, but not so large that it cancels out the point of short lifetimes.
- Expect: so is HS256 unusable? Answer that it is fine when one service signs and verifies its own tokens, and it is faster. The criterion is whether signer and verifier sit in the same trust domain; across domains, asymmetric is mandatory. Framing it as a trade-off shows judgment rather than memorization.
答题要点
- 机制:私钥签名、公钥集合挂在固定地址、令牌头部带 kid、验签方按 kid 取公钥
- 轮换不用两边同时发版:新旧公钥并存,等老令牌自然过期再摘旧的
- 验签方只拿到验签能力而不是签名能力,被入侵也伪造不出令牌
- 调用方增加不需要多散一份密钥,公钥公开本来就是设计意图
- 验签之外必须校验 iss、aud、exp,漏掉 aud 等于替别的下游服务开门
- 缓存公钥集合但要能按未知 kid 主动重拉;HS256 在同一信任域内自签自验仍然是合理选择
Key points
- Mechanism: private key signs, public key set sits at a fixed URL, the token header carries a kid, the verifier selects by kid
- Rotation needs no synchronized deploy: publish the new key, let both coexist, retire the old one after old tokens expire
- The verifier gets verification power only, never signing power, so compromising it cannot forge tokens
- Adding callers does not scatter more secrets; the public key being public is the design intent
- Beyond the signature you must check iss, aud and exp — skipping aud opens your API to tokens signed for someone else
- Cache the key set but refetch on an unknown kid; HS256 is still reasonable when one service signs and verifies its own tokens
设计一组给外部服务调用的 Agent 平台接口,你会怎么划分职责边界?You are designing the API surface an Agent platform exposes to other services. How do you draw the responsibility boundaries?
国内高频海外高频深入#api-design#security#architecture分析过程 · 先想清楚再作答
- 这是开放题,考的是你有没有一条能反复用的划分依据。上来就罗列接口清单的人会被追问到没词;先给依据再给清单的人,追问反而是加分机会。
- 给一条判据:**按「谁拥有这份数据」划,不按「谁调用它」划。** 会话、执行记录、记忆、成本台账都属于平台,所以平台开的三个口子恰好是「写一条进来(inject)」「读写记忆(memory)」「查账(usage)」;编排逻辑属于对方,平台就不该提供「帮我跑一遍这个图」的接口——那是把对方的职责搬到自己身上,将来两边都改不动。
- 第二条判据是**贯穿全课的安全不变量:身份只能来自令牌,不能来自请求体**。所有接口都不接受 userId 参数,服务端一律从令牌的 sub 取。这条一旦破例,权限模型就整个塌了:查成本的接口如果接受 userId 查询参数,任何一张有效令牌都能遍历所有人的消费金额。同一条原则在 D12 的记忆检索工具上也出现过——不给模型身份参数,服务端自己填。
- 第三条是**返回粒度要按最小必要给**。usage 只返回汇总不返回明细,因为明细里带着执行 id 和模型选型,等于把平台的内部策略一并交出去;memory 要支持按 query 检索并限制条数,不提供「把这个人的所有记忆倒出来」的接口——一旦提供,它迟早会被某个图省事的调用方用成默认写法。
- 第四条是**每个写接口都要能被安全重放**:带 externalId、唯一约束兜底、重复返回 200。跨服务调用一定会重复,这不是要不要做的问题。
- 可以预期的追问:那限流按什么维度做?答「每用户,不是每调用方」——按调用方限流的话,一个用户的异常重试会把所有人的额度吃光;另外写接口要防回环,注入的消息要打来源标记,否则两个服务能把彼此拉进无限循环,账单是唯一会提醒你的东西。
How to reason about it · think before answering
- This is an open design question testing whether you have a reusable criterion. Candidates who start listing endpoints run out of material under follow-ups; candidates who give the criterion first turn follow-ups into extra points.
- Offer the criterion: draw boundaries by who owns the data, not by who calls it. Sessions, run records, memories and the cost ledger belong to the platform, so the platform exposes exactly three things — write one event in (inject), read and write memory, and read usage. Orchestration belongs to the caller, so the platform should not offer run this graph for me; that pulls someone else's responsibility inside your walls and freezes both sides.
- Second criterion, the security invariant that runs through the whole course: identity comes from the token, never from the request body. No endpoint accepts a userId; the server always reads sub. Break this once and the authorization model collapses — a usage endpoint that accepts a userId query parameter lets any valid token enumerate everyone's spend. The same principle appeared on the memory search tool: the model gets no identity parameter, the server fills it in.
- Third, return the minimum necessary. Usage returns aggregates, not line items, because line items carry run ids and model choices — that hands over your internal strategy. Memory supports a query with a result limit rather than dump everything this user ever said; once that exists, some caller in a hurry will make it the default.
- Fourth, every write endpoint must be safely replayable: an externalId, a uniqueness constraint underneath, and 200 on a repeat. Cross-service calls will be duplicated; this is not optional.
- Expect: what dimension do you rate-limit on? Per user, not per caller — limiting per caller lets one user's runaway retries consume everyone's budget. Also guard against loops: tag injected messages with their source, or two services can pull each other into an infinite cycle and the bill is the only thing that tells you.
答题要点
- 按「谁拥有这份数据」划边界,不按「谁调用」划:会话、记忆、台账属于平台,编排属于对方
- 三个口子对应三种所有权:inject 写入、memory 读写、usage 查账;不提供「帮我跑图」这种越界接口
- 所有接口都不接受 userId 参数,身份一律从令牌 sub 取——这条破例一次权限模型就塌了
- 返回粒度按最小必要:usage 只给汇总不给明细,memory 按 query 限条数而不是全量倒出
- 每个写接口都带 externalId 并由唯一约束兜底,重复返回 200
- 限流按每用户而不是每调用方;注入的消息要打来源标记防止两个服务互相回环
Key points
- Draw boundaries by data ownership, not by caller: sessions, memory and the ledger belong to the platform, orchestration belongs to the caller
- Three endpoints for three kinds of ownership — inject, memory, usage — and no run this graph for me endpoint that crosses the line
- No endpoint accepts a userId; identity always comes from the token's sub, and one exception collapses the model
- Return the minimum necessary: usage gives aggregates only, memory takes a query with a limit instead of dumping everything
- Every write endpoint carries an externalId backed by a uniqueness constraint and answers 200 on repeats
- Rate-limit per user rather than per caller, and tag injected messages with their source so two services cannot loop forever
